Old Avon Bridge

The old bridge in Avonwick, South Devon – taken from the tree lined riverbank on the edge of the ancient ‘green lane’ looking Northwest.

Canon A570 IS (compact) + Kodak tripod

Panorama of two images [5 manually bracketed shots (-2, -1, 0, 1, 1.66) at f/8 per section] merged with Canon Photostitch

HDR and tone mapping in Photomatix Pro 3.1
